Air allergies, also known as allergic rhinitis, are a common condition affecting millions of people worldwide. They occur when your immune system overreacts to harmless airborne substances, leading to a range of uncomfortable symptoms. Understanding the causes, symptoms, and management strategies for air allergies can significantly improve your quality of life.

Causes of Air Allergies

Air allergies can be triggered by a variety of airborne substances, including:

  • Pollen: Trees, grasses, and weeds release pollen into the air, which can trigger all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
  • Dust Mites: These microscopic creatures thrive in warm, humid environments and are commonly found in bedding, upholstered furniture, and carpeting.
  • Mold Spores: Mold grows in damp, dark environments and releases spores into the air that can cause allergic reactions.
  • Pet Dander: Although not airborne, tiny particles of skin and fur from pets can become airborne and trigger allergic reactions.
  • Other Airborne Particles: Insect waste, smoke, and certain chemicals can also cause air allergies in some people.

Symptoms of Air Allergies

The symptoms of air allergies can vary from person to person, but they typically include:

  • Sneezing
  • Runny or stuffy nose
  • Itchy, watery eyes
  • Itchy nose, throat, or roof of the mouth
  • Postnasal drip
  • Cough
  • Swollen, blue-colored skin under the eyes (allergic shiners)
  • Ear itching or fullness

When to See a Doctor

While air allergies are generally not life-threatening, they can significantly impact your quality of life. If your symptoms are severe, persistent, or accompanied by fever, you should consult a healthcare professional. Additionally, if you experience difficulty breathing, wheezing, or chest tightness, seek immediate medical attention, as these could be signs of a severe allergic reaction (anaphylaxis).

Managing Air Allergies

There is no cure for air allergies, but several strategies can help manage symptoms and improve quality of life. These include:

Medications

Over-the-counter and prescription medications can help alleviate air allergy symptoms. These include antihistamines, decongestants, nasal corticosteroids, and leukotriene inhibitors. Your doctor can help determine the most appropriate medication for your specific needs.

Allergy Shots (Immunotherapy)

Allergy shots involve receiving regular injections containing small amounts of the allergens that trigger your symptoms. Over time, these injections help your body build tolerance to the allergens, reducing your sensitivity and symptoms. Immunotherapy can be an effective long-term solution for managing air allergies.

Sublingual Immunotherapy (SLIT)

Sublingual immunotherapy involves placing a tablet or drop containing a small amount of allergen under your tongue. Like allergy shots, SLIT helps your body build tolerance to the allergens, reducing your sensitivity and symptoms. SLIT is a convenient, at-home treatment option for some people.

Lifestyle Changes

Adopting certain lifestyle changes can help minimize your exposure to allergens and alleviate symptoms. These may include:

  • Monitoring pollen counts and staying indoors during peak allergy seasons
  • Using air purifiers and keeping windows closed to reduce indoor allergens
  • Wearing a mask when doing outdoor chores or engaging in activities that expose you to allergens
  • Avoiding triggers, such as smoking, strong perfumes, and other irritants
  • Rinsing nasal passages with saline to remove allergens

Alternative Therapies

Some people find relief from air allergy symptoms through alternative therapies, such as acupuncture, herbal supplements, or nasal irrigation. While these therapies may provide some relief, it's essential to consult a healthcare professional before trying them, as their effectiveness and safety may vary.

Living with Air Allergies

Air allergies can be a chronic condition, but with the right management strategies, it's possible to lead a full, active life. By understanding your triggers, seeking appropriate treatment, and adopting lifestyle changes, you can effectively manage your air allergies and improve your overall well-being.
